#d2fe42 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d2fe42 is composed of 82.4% red, 99.6% green and 25.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 17.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 74%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 74 degrees, a saturation of 98.9% and a lightness of 62.7%. #d2fe42 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ff84 with #a5fd00. Closest websafe color is: #ccff33.

#d2fe42 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d2fe42 has RGB values of R:210, G:254, B:66 and CMYK values of C:0.17, M:0, Y:0.74, K:0. Its decimal value is 13827650.
